Contractor Chappelow Sports Turf has further extended its capability to deliver construction, drainage and maintenance services across sport, leisure and amenity by expanding its fleet of high-performance tractors.

Two John Deere 6125R models are the latest additions to the lineup, which spans compact units to some of the most powerful the manufacturer produces.

The acquisitions follow burgeoning demand for increasingly important improvements to sports pitches and golf courses, which help grounds and greens teams raise performance standards and minimise closures and fixture cancellations due to bad weather.

"We stay true to John Deere because of their reliability," said Ben Chappelow, who runs the business with his brother, Edward, and dad Alan. "There have been few if any problems with the fleet, having bought our first tractor more than a decade ago.

"The service is great from Ripon Farm Services, our local John Deere dealer," added Chappelow. "They provide strong backup and can deliver spares usually the day after we order them."

Chris Doyle, Ripon's Service Manager, added: "As well as supplying models for sport and amenity, the dealership runs a thriving agricultural division but stressed: "Our longstanding relationship with Chappelow Sports Turf is proof of the rising requirement for the turf care services that their expanding fleet of tractors allows them to provide across the board."

Chappelow is just a "stone's-throw" from its goal of running a tractor fleet that will give the contractor full rein to provide services for sites as diverse as a single football pitch or local cricket field to the largest sports stadia and golf complexes. "We're nearly there," Ben Chappelow said, "and shortly expect to close another deal with Ripon to give us complete capability."
